Flin is a unique and charming name that has been gaining popularity in recent years. It is a name that has a rich history and a deep meaning. The name Flin is of Irish origin and is derived from the Gaelic word "flann," which means "red" or "ruddy." In Irish mythology, Flann was the name of a warrior who was known for his bravery and strength. The name Flin has a strong and powerful sound to it, which makes it a great choice for parents who are looking for a name that will make their child stand out. It is a name that is easy to pronounce and spell, which is important for children as they grow up and learn to write their own name. One of the great things about the name Flin is that it is gender-neutral, which means that it can be used for both boys and girls. This is a great option for parents who are looking for a name that is not tied to a specific gender. The name Flin has a number of different variations and spellings, including Flynn, Flinn, and Flan. Each of these variations has its own unique meaning and history, but they all share the same basic meaning of "red" or "ruddy."
